For 3 and 4 Quarter: Teachers are free to choose what elements of music he/she think is necessary to apply to the student’s specialization.
• Rhythm (Beat, Meter, Note Values)
• Melody (Modes, Tonality, Scales)
• Harmony (Intervals & Triads)
• Tempo (Adagio, Moderato, Allegro, Presto, Vivace)
• Dynamics (piano, forte, mezzo piano, mezzo forte)
• Timbre (vocal, instrumental, environmental)
• Form (Cyclic, Phrases, Period, Section, Binary, Ternary, Rounded Binary, Rondo, Song Forms)
• Basic Music Reading: Notes, Rests, Time Signature, Clefs
